Job Summary
We are currently seeking a meticulous and detail-oriented individual to join our team as an Inventory Officer at our facility in Awka, Anambra State. The Inventory Officer will be responsible for overseeing and managing inventory levels to ensure accuracy and efficiency in our operations.
Responsibilities:
Maintain accurate records of inventory levels, including stock counts, movements, and adjustments.
Conduct regular inventory audits to reconcile physical stock with system records.
Coordinate with procurement and warehouse teams for timely inventory receipt and storage.
Handle inventory issuance and returns, resolving any discrepancies.
Generate reports on inventory status, stock movements, and variances for management review.
Implement and uphold inventory control procedures to minimize losses.
Collaborate with departments for future stock needs.
Ensure compliance with company policies and regulations.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Supply Chain Management, or related field.
1-2 years of inventory management experience.
Proficiency in inventory management software and Microsoft Excel.
Strong organizational and communication skills.
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
Ability to analyze data and generate reports to support decision-making.
Willingness to adapt to changing priorities and learn new systems or processes.
